Job Description

We're looking for a Customer Insight & Performance Analyst to help us understand how our services are performing and how our customers experience them. In this role, you'll turn data into clear insight, helping teams monitor performance, identify trends, and make informed decisions that improve outcomes for customers and partners.

Job Responsibility

  • Provide accurate and meaningful performance data to support reporting across the partnership and meet agreed deadlines
  • Monitor targets, investigate performance trends and variances, and communicate clear findings to stakeholders
  • Check the quality, accuracy, and consistency of data received from subcontractors and partners, escalating issues where needed
  • Support the design, collection, and reporting of customer satisfaction and feedback data to generate actionable insight
  • Support the review and development of systems and digital tools used for performance monitoring and customer insight
  • Produce reports and presentations for a range of audiences, including senior stakeholders, that are clear, relevant, and accessible

Requirements

  • Experience analysing and interpreting performance or customer data to support decision-making
  • Strong numerical and analytical skills, with the ability to identify trends, risks, and opportunities for improvement
  • Experience producing clear reports, dashboards, or presentations for a range of stakeholders
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, with the ability to work collaboratively across teams and partners
